Phytomyza gymnostoma

Phytomyza gymnostoma, common name onion leaf miner or allium leafminer, is a species of leaf miner and a agricultural pest, specialising in crops in the Allium genus. These plants include onions, leeks, and garlic. It is native to mainland Europe, but was first detected in England in 2002, and North America in 2015. They are bivoltine, meaning they produce two generations per year.
